(a) Upon request of the director and with the approval of the management council or the management audit committee, each officer, board, commission, department or any political subdivision of state government or any local government shall provide assistance, documents and information to the legislative service office. (b) In preparing fiscal and personnel notes for proposed legislation as required by joint rule of the legislature, the state budget department and any agency or department of state government shall furnish any information or assistance relative thereto as soon as reasonably practicable upon request of the director.
